Champagne Deutz Brut Classic

The pop of Champagne (Champs) is always such a lovely sound and such a great way to start any occasion! I like to try new Champagne from all the great houses in France, not mainstream marketed but hidden gems that you must seek out. It's fun and a educational process as well...

One of the oldest producers is Deutz, Deutz has been produced by five generations of the same family since 1838. Deutz Brut Classic owes its remarkable taste to a blend of Pinot Noir, Pinot Meunier and Chardonnay grapes...They are collected from Montagne de Reims and villages around Epernay.

This Champagne is golden honey orange, to the nose Carmel, floral notes and a slight citrus touch, to the taste peaches and apricots, well rounded, complex, perfect amount of acidity, long finish and completely elegant and delicious...By far one of my favorite Champagnes...

The price point is under $40, which is an exceptional value given the pedigree...Once you seek it out and try this incredible Champagne, I know you will agree..........this will pop on Champs night!
